Transaction 11049d4292e65eb02d9c55d92665d325a0fd6671eda02ec68680a22de33a9aae

1 Input
1 Outputs
  • 11049d4292e65eb02d9c55d92665d325a0fd6671eda02ec68680a22de33a9aae:0
  • value  2561184548
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Y